Our Victories

The following wins result from the collective efforts of over 2,000 graduate workers and countless allies. Since 2018, we have engaged in public marches, petitions, a fee strike, our Spring 2022 Graduate Worker Strike, and our Spring 2024 “Three Days For A Raise” Strike.

  • We eliminated fees, including international student fees!

    • August 2022: IU waived the mandatory graduate student fees of $1,435 paid by all SAAs as well as some course-specific fees for SAAs in programs that charge them. (See full story here.)

    • September 2022: IU waived the international student fee and the G901 fee for SAAs. (See full story here.)

  • We won wage increases!

    • August 2022: After almost 10 years of stagnant wages, IU raised the minimum SAA stipends to $22,000, a 46% increase over the minimum SAA stipend of $15,000 in Fall 2021. Some departments were previously paid as little as $7,000 a year. IU also committed to ensure “minimum stipends and discipline-specific stipend rates remain in the top half of the Big Ten” going forward, with a mandatory review process for SAA stipends to be conducted every two years. (See full story here.)

    • July 2023: IU gave a 3% raise ($660 a year) to returning SAAs for the 2023–2024 academic year. (See the Dean’s Memo here.)

  • We won healthcare and other benefits!

    • October 2022: IU changed its Leaves of Absence policy to provide full insurance benefits to SAAs on medical or parental leave, including unpaid leaves, for up to six months. (See full story here and the policy here.)

    • 2023: IU restored the SAA Affairs Committee on the Bloomington Faculty Council (BFC), and the BFC passed a new policy for the SAA Board of Review, which reviews graduate student grievances and complaints related to the terms and conditions of their academic appointments. (See more info here.)
